I called the direct 407 S&D phone number today and booked a room for spring break. The confirmation number will not link in MDE OR in the Marriott app. I also did not get the email confirmation.

is this normal? Should I call back?
 
I called the direct 407 S&D phone number today and booked a room for spring break. The confirmation number will not link in MDE OR in the Marriott app. I also did not get the email confirmation.

is this normal? Should I call back?
It usually takes 24-48 hours for the Swan or Dolphin confirmation number to be processed into Disney's system. Sometimes, it will go through overnight. So, try again Wednesday morning, to see if you can link the reservation to MDE. If after a couple of days it still does not work, call back to onsite reservations and request that they resend the info to Disney.

From MDE:

It may take up to 72 hours before you're able to link a reservation to your account if staying at the Walt Disney World Dolphin Hotel, Walt Disney World Swan Hotel,

We’re booked in a King Alcove at the Swan. The phone agent on the direct line said it would work great for our family of five with a king, pullout sofa, and rollaway. I hope so! Our kids are young.

She also said there would be no charge for the rollaway in this type of Swan room. Is that true?
 
My real concern was that it wouldn’t show in the Marriott app, but it is now. :) Thanks!

We’re booked in a King Alcove at the Swan. The phone agent on the direct line said it would work great for our family of five with a king, pullout sofa, and rollaway. I hope so! Our kids are young.

She also said there would be no charge for the rollaway in this type of Swan room. Is that true?
This description of the Swan's King Alcove room is from Marriott's site (https://www.marriott.com/hotels/hotel-rooms/mcodw-walt-disney-world-swan/):

Beds and Bedding
  • Maximum Occupancy: 4
  • 1 King
  • Sofa bed
  • Rollaway beds permitted: 1 at 25.00 USD per night
  • Cribs permitted: 1
  • Maximum cribs/rollaway beds permitted: 1
  • Pillowtop mattress, and Duvet

Are you sure it was not the Dolphin, which will allow capacity of two adults + 3 children? (https://www.marriott.com/hotels/hotel-rooms/mcosi-walt-disney-world-dolphin/)

Beds and Bedding
  • Maximum Occupancy: 5
  • 1 King
  • Sofa bed
  • Rollaway beds permitted: 1 at 25.00 USD per night
  • Cribs permitted: 1
  • Maximum cribs/rollaway beds permitted: 2
  • Pillowtop mattress, Featherbed, and Duvet


What time did you call the reservation number? If you called during a time when the onsite reservation line was closed, you would automatically be connected to the Marriott reservation line. Normally, the onsite reservation staff is very good.

Value Days calendar now shows dates into March 2021. Almost all of January and much of February are classified as Value Days for both the Swan and Dolphin. Only Sundays are shown as Value Days in March.

https://www.swandolphin.com/value-days/
(I wish the DIS would fix the glitch for attaching links!)

UPDATE: The calendar now has half of March and Sundays in April noted as Value Days.
